Apple Games, Apple Arcade, and Game Center are the home of gaming on Apple's platforms — iPhone, iPad, Mac, Apple TV, and Vision Pro. Join the Game Services UI team to help build the Apple Games app and the user-facing gaming features, frameworks, and developer integrations that sit alongside it. We have an exciting roadmap supporting games ranging from mobile to indie to AAA, reaching deep into the operating system, with the unique opportunity to help define the face of gaming 're looking for a proactive, highly motivated engineer who takes pride in crafting uniquely beautiful and robust user interfaces with Apple's frameworks — and who wants to build something phenomenal alongside a collaborative, quality-obsessed team.
DescriptionIn this role you'll implement new features in existing UIs and frameworks, and design and build sophisticated new experiences from top to bottom. Your day-to-day is primarily Swift and Swift
UI, with UIKit or App Kit used where the situation calls for it. You'll ship features that reach hundreds of millions of players and shape APIs that game developers rely on. You should bring excellent Swift skills, strong object-oriented design sensibility, a passion for quality, an eye for detail, and strong problem-solving, critical-thinking, and interpersonal skills.
- As an engineer on the Game Services UI team, you'll develop and improve the Apple Games app, the Game Overlay, and the UI frameworks that power multiplayer experiences, achievements, leaderboards, and other social gaming features across Apple's platforms. You'll partner closely with platform teams, game developers, and the Apple Games Framework team to deliver flawless gaming experiences, and advocate for outstanding development practices as you go.

At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$181,100 and $272,100,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.
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ple’s disc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You'll also receive benefits including:
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ses — including tuition. Additionally, this role might be eligible for discretionary bonuses or commission payments as well as relocation. Learn more about Apple Benefits
